Sen. Debbie Stabenow (D-MI) has sent an e-mail to her supporter list, launching a “moneybomb” fundraiser in response to the TV ad from Senate candidate and former Rep. Pete Hoekstra (R-MI) — which featured an Asian-American actress speaking in broken English, to “thank” Stabenow for spending and borrowing money from China.

Key quote from the Stabenow e-mail, with emphasis in the original:

Even Republicans called it “appalling” – not only for the ad’s offensiveness, but also for the hypocrisy.

Rep. Hoekstra voted for the $700 billion Wall Street bailout – which Debbie voted against. He voted for the unfunded Bush tax cuts, the war in Iraq, and government handouts for big oil companies – all things Debbie voted against.

For $1 trillion – the cost of the Bush tax cuts – Rep. Hoekstra could have bought nearly 7 MILLION of those ads. That means you’d be stuck watching nothing but Hoekstra’s awful ad on repeat until March 10, 2209!
